**Off-site run — item 4: safe's replacement lock**

Grab the new lock unit from Keldway Locksmiths before noon — it's boxed and paid for, just needs a signature. Keep it in the cab, not the back, and don't mention which site it's for if anyone asks. One last bit for the hand-over, kept confidential, straight below here.

handover note for yagef-bagep: the drudor pelius courier leaves the kasdor zorvan norir ledger at gate 8016 under passcode 755406

**Alert: Canary gate blocked — plugin compatibility check failed**

The Osprey deploy system halts a canary rollout when a registered plugin reports an error rate above 0.5% or fails its handshake probe twice within the bake window. Blocked plugins are not promoted to the stable ring until re-validated. The full gating rules and bake-window thresholds are published here:

wiki page, bagaf-fawip: https://harbor.tolvaqsys.local/pages/repo/pages/secrets/eac969ffc71f356b

[ ] Public REST pagination: cursor tokens opaque, stable across deploys; page size capped at 100; next/prev links absolute. Regression test covers empty final page. Confirm docs examples match Fernvale staging responses. Validated against the build identified by the token below.

session token of tajef-bageg = htk21_5d90d574934f3ccae6437

## StormFan Data Stores

StormFan fans out weather alerts from the Gale ingest queue to regional topics. Alert state lives in Postgres; dedupe keys in the Brimble cache expire after 15 minutes. Replays read from the same primary — do not point them at the replica. Connect to the alert-state database using the string below.

replica DSN, yahaf-yagaf: mongodb://tamath_svc:a2netSk3RZMuTj@db-d084.novacsoft.internal:5432/ralmir

Escalation — Wrenbox restock planner. If the nightly route optimizer fails twice consecutively, or produces routes covering fewer than 80% of active machines, page the planning on-call first; they can rerun with the fallback heuristic, which is slower but reliable. If machine telemetry itself looks stale (no fill-level updates for six hours), the issue is upstream in the Copperline ingest service and must be escalated there. For business-impact questions, contact the field-ops duty manager.

escalation mailbox, bafog-fafog: ulador@paliqlabs.internal